How muddy does it get?

I presume you mean the trail center ? it gets a bit of mud on the surface at the bottom but not squady its fairly good drainage my only problem is when you start climbing an the draining is better the drier sand sticks to the wet mud an can sound horrible on your drive chain ... this aside the grip is still fairly good an rolls well ! have fun

There can be a lot of standing water when it's raining, overshoes, rear mudguard / waterproof shorts could be useful.
